Long-term low-level ambient air pollution exposure and risk of lung cancer - A pooled analysis of 7 European cohorts

Ulla Arthur Hvidtfeldt et al.

Summary: This study, pooling data from seven cohorts across Europe, found that long-term low-level PM2.5 exposure was associated with lung cancer incidence, even below current EU limit values. There was no observed association between NO2, BC, or O-3 and lung cancer incidence. The results suggest a linear or supra-linear association between PM2.5 exposure and lung cancer risk, with no evidence of a threshold.

Global cancer statistics 2020: GLOBOCAN estimates of incidence and mortality worldwide for 36 cancers in 185 countries

Hyuna Sung et al.

Summary: The global cancer burden in 2020 saw an estimated 19.3 million new cancer cases and almost 10.0 million cancer deaths. Female breast cancer surpassed lung cancer as the most commonly diagnosed cancer, while lung cancer remained the leading cause of cancer death. These trends are expected to rise in 2040, with transitioning countries experiencing a larger increase compared to transitioned countries due to demographic changes and risk factors associated with globalization and a growing economy. Efforts to improve cancer prevention measures and provision of cancer care in transitioning countries will be crucial for global cancer control.

Occupational exposure to pesticides and central nervous system tumors: results from the CERENAT case-control study

Isabelle Baldi et al.

Summary: This study found that occupational pesticide exposure, both in agriculture and outside, may increase the risk of central nervous system tumors, especially when exposed for more than 10 years in agriculture or in open field agriculture.
